srand((unsigned)time(NULL));intiRange1=0xf7-0xb0;intiRange2=0xfe-0xa1;for(inti=0;i<10;++i){BYTEiCode1=rand()%iRange1+0xb0;BYTEiCode2=rand()%iRange2+0xa1;charch[3]={iCode1,iCode2,0};}char类型ch为生成的汉字,如果要合成汉字字符串,使用lstrcat((target字符串)des,ch(源字符串));括号中的汉字为2字节解释,第一个字节为0xB0到0xF7,第二个字节为0xa1到0xFE。0xF7A1的最后一段,结尾有几个字。楼主只需要生成1个字节0xB0~0xF6和2个字节0xa1~0xFE,足够随机了。分两步随机生成汉字,汉字为双字节高字节范围为x1-x2(自己查)高字节范围为y1-y2(自己查)1.随机生成两个索引srand(GetTickCount());nLowPart=rand()%(x2-x1+1)+x1;nHighPart=rand()%(y2-y1+1)+y1;2。拼接索引显示的是汉字unsignedcharChine...给大家整理一下背景开发相关的面试知识点脑图。这是一个片段:您可以添加qun来获取它。
